CHIEF EXECUTIVE OFFICER
Canadian Energy Regulator,
Calgary, AB
Located in Calgary, Alberta, the Canada Energy Regulator serves as an independent energy lifecycle regulator responsible for federally regulated pipelines and power lines, energy development and trade.
Under the Canadian Energy Regulator Act, the Canada Energy Regulator has a Chief Executive Officer who is appointed by the Governor in Council. The Chief Executive Officer has the rank, powers and accountabilities of a Deputy Head. The Chief Executive Officer:
- provides effective management of the Canada Energy Regulator and ensures strategic alignment between the Commission, the Board of Directors, and management;
- manages the Regulator’s day-to-day business and affairs, including the supervision of its employees and their work;
- provides technical and administrative support and resources to the Board of Directors and the Commission; and
- collaborates with other federal partner organizations, including supporting the Commissioners in their work with the Impact Assessment Agency of Canada to ensure they are well informed and can effectively undertake single, integrated project reviews for “designated projects.”

COMMUNICATIONS AND STAKEHOLDER RELATIONS COORDINATOR (BILINGUAL)
College of Early Childhood Educators
, Toronto, ON
The College of Early Childhood Educators (the College) regulates the more than 53,000 members of the early childhood education profession in the public interest, pursuant to the Early Childhood Educators Act, 2007. The College issues Certificates of Registration, has established a Code of Ethics and Standards of Practice for the profession, and responds to concerns about members through a complaints and discipline process. The College is a not-for-profit organization with a staff of 65 and an annual operating budget of approximately $10M.
We are seeking a collaborative, responsive, fluid bilingual communicator (English and French) accountable for communicating the purpose, values and activities of the College to the public, members and stakeholders through print and digital communications. As a brand ambassador, this position will provide communication advice to other departments in order to uphold the brand, tone and communications style of the College.

PROFESSIONAL CONDUCT REVIEW OFFICER
Real Estate Council of Alberta
, Calgary, AB
The Real Estate Council of Alberta is the independent governing authority that sets, regulates, and enforces standards for real estate brokerage, mortgage brokerage, property management, and real estate appraisal professionals in Alberta. RECA’s mandate is to protect consumers, and to provide services that enhance and improve the industry and the business of industry professionals.
The Real Estate Council of Alberta (RECA) is seeking a Professional Conduct Review Officer (investigator) to fill a 1-year term. As a Professional Conduct Review Officer, and, on behalf of the executive director, you will investigate possible breaches of the Real Estate Act by objectively gathering all relevant facts and safeguarding evidence.

TRIBUNAL COMMITTEE - MEMBER (RCIC APPOINTMENTS)
Immigration Consultants of Canada Regulatory Council,
Burlington, ON
The Immigration Consultants of Canada Regulatory Council (ICCRC) is the national regulatory body that promotes and protects the public interest by overseeing regulated immigration consultants and international student advisors. ICCRC establishes effective policies, practices, and procedures to regulate and educate immigration consultants.
ICCRC is looking to build and strengthen its Tribunal Committee in support of our mandate to investigate and resolve concerns and complaints about members, balancing public protection with a fair and objective process. The main objective of our Tribunal Committee is to resolve or hear cases regarding professional conduct and capacity issues. Each hearing panel will include a Vice-Chair and two Tribunal Members who will make the decision.
